NEGOTIATIONS TEAM
 Composition: Persons in the positions of:
RFT President
Chairperson(s) of the Negotiation Back-Up Committee
Up to six (6) persons to be recommended by a Special Selection Task Force
Selection Process: There will be a Negotiations Team Selection Task Force composed of two (2) RFT Officers appointed by the RFT President and two (2) members of the Executive Council
RFT members who desire a position on the 2021-2023 Negotiations Team will submit an application form to the Selection Task Force Committee.
The Selection Task Force Committee will review the applications and make recommendations to the RFT President.
The RFT President will appoint up to six members for the Negotiation Team based upon the Selection Task Force recommendations.
Criteria for Selection:
Applicants must be a member in good standing for the preceding and current school year.
Applicants must be willing to attend training sessions and seminars.
Applicants must be available for negotiation sessions held during the summer months as well as the entire negotiating period.
Applicants should have background, knowledge, or experience in structure and functioning of the RFT and the Collective Bargaining Contract.
Job Responsibilities:
Attend training sessions, planning meetings, and negotiation seminars.
Collect and read data required to make reasoned decisions in the best interest of the entire RFT membership.
Help communicate the negotiation process.
